One of the elemental elements of comparing vintages is understanding the importance of terroir, the distinctive environmental conditions of a selected vineyard website. Terroir encompasses soil composition, local weather, and the micro-ecosystem that collectively shape the traits of the grapes grown there. Vintages from the identical property can differ significantly when climate patterns fluctuate from 12 months to year, illustrating how terroir interacts with local weather to provide distinctive wines.
When tasting various vintages, one usually notices the evolution of fruit flavors and supporting structures like acidity and tannins. A young wine could showcase fresh, vibrant fruit characteristics that may fade with age, while older vintages may reveal extra complexity, including tertiary aromas and flavors like leather, tobacco, or dried fruits. These modifications happen due to gradual chemical reactions that develop over time, offering an interesting realm for exploration during tastings.

Wine aging is another important factor that could be explored during vintage comparisons. Many wines get pleasure from aging, permitting flavors to combine and mellow over time. Nonetheless, not all wines are suitable for long-term cellaring. Understanding which vintages would possibly stand the check of time versus these finest loved younger could be a priceless lesson for novices and seasoned drinkers alike.
Wine style can also be an important point of comparability. For instance, a winery might produce each an property vintage and a reserve vintage. The differences in manufacturing methods, together with selection standards for grapes and aging techniques, can yield markedly different wines. Comparing these styles from numerous vintages can highlight the range throughout the same winery, illustrating the winemaker's philosophy and the impact of every year’s conditions.
